What's your signal path with this configuration?

I think I was recording bass on this pic. So I was running

Bass to Art Tubepac preamp via 1/4"

Preamp to UCA-222 interface input via 1/4 out to RCA adapter

Preamp to Mixer via XLR to 1/4 TRS

UCA-222 Monitor out to mixer tape in via RCA cables

Then I just set my levels with the preamp into the interface, and monitor everything through the mixer. That way I can control the levels in my ear without disrupting the recording

u sure those are enough controls? adjust ur vol, blend, highs, mids, lows, heart rate, blood pressure, etc. lol


Actually it's not as complex as it looks.  Total of 8 knobs.  1 master volume, 1 neck pickup volume, 1 bridge pick up volume.  So that leaves 5 more.

1 is an on/off/ pickup selector.  So there are really only 4 knobs for tone shaping.  2 for each pickup.  1 sets the central boosting frequency for the low pass filter, the other sets the amount of boost.  Arguably, those could be stacked.

On the other hand, anything that needs 2 paragraphs to explain.........

(http://i590.photobucket.com/albums/ss348/martinjlm/Alembic%20Basses/HPIM2671.jpg)

By comparison, the Roscoe that's shown in the same picture LOOKS like it only has 4 knobs, but one is stacked, so that's 2 controls, and another is a push pull, so that's 2 controls.  Now that's a total of 6 control points and only one of them controls volume, so 5 different tone controls.  The Alembic has 4 tone controls.

Different approaches.
